Please check the Sheffield Hallam University website for the latest course information. Course summary: - Enhance and develop your leadership and management skills.
-
Foster excellence in practice to meet the challenges involved in complex care provision.
-
Develop detailed knowledge and meet the Standards for Specialist Practice.
-
Develop personal resilience as an autonomous and independent decision maker.
Aimed at students who can demonstrate their ability to study at the required level, this course helps you to extend and develop a critical understanding of the advances in district nursing practice. You will learn how to maximise relationships with key partners and coordinate care for people in their own homes and other environments.
